player

[C] Countable

In a sporting context, the term carries a sense of participation and skill, often implying a specific role within a team structure. It evokes the image of competition, physical exertion, and strategic movement on a field or court. When applied to social or romantic dynamics, the word shifts into a pejorative light. It suggests a calculated, game-like approach to human emotion, where the individual views dating as a series of wins and losses rather than a search for genuine connection.

The word is always countable whether referring to an athlete, a piece of hardware, or a deceptive romantic partner.

Meanings

Noun
[someone]

A person who takes part in a game or sport.

"The star player scored the winning goal."

Noun
[something]

A device used for playing recorded music or video.

"He bought a new portable CD player."

Noun
[someone]

A person who engages in romantic relationships without intending to commit.

"He has a reputation for being a player in the dating scene."
